Exceptional Durability
You know what’s amazing about aluminium doors? They laugh in the face of weather.
Rain, snow, blazing sun – aluminium just shrugs it off.
Unlike wood doors that can warp and rot after a few seasons of harsh weather, aluminium doors keep looking great year after year.
They don’t rust like steel, they don’t crack like vinyl in cold weather, and they don’t swell up when it gets humid.
I’ve seen aluminium doors on beach houses that face salty ocean air daily and still look fantastic after ten years.
That kind of staying power means you won’t be shopping for replacement doors anytime soon.
Most aluminium doors come with warranties of 20+ years, but honestly, they often last much longer than that.
When you break down the cost over that many years, they’re actually super budget-friendly.
Low Maintenance Requirements
Nobody wants to spend their weekends maintaining doors.
With aluminium, you pretty much install them and forget about them.
Aluminium bifolding doors require minimal treatment to retain their strength and form.
A simple wipe down with soapy water once or twice a year keeps them looking fresh.
No sanding, no painting, no staining, no sealing—just clean them occasionally and you’re good to go.
Compare that to wood doors, which need regular sanding, staining, and sealing to keep them from weathering.
Or vinyl doors that can get brittle and discolored over time.
The finish on quality aluminium doors is typically a powder coating or anodized layer that bonds to the metal at a molecular level.
This isn’t like paint that can chip or peel—it becomes part of the door itself.
That means the color stays true and doesn’t fade, even with years of sun exposure.
For busy homeowners (and who isn’t busy these days?), this low-maintenance feature is a huge selling point.

Superior Strength-to-Weight Ratio
Aluminium has this cool superpower: it’s incredibly strong for how light it is. This makes it perfect for large doors that need to be opened and closed regularly.
Think about those big sliding glass doors that lead to patios.
If they were made of solid wood or steel, they’d be super heavy and hard to move.
But aluminium gives you the strength without the weight, so even kids can open and close them easily.
This lightweight quality also puts less stress on hinges and tracks, which means fewer mechanical problems over time.
Your doors will glide smoothly for years without sagging or sticking.
For larger door installations like bifold systems that open up an entire wall, aluminium is really the only practical option.
It’s strong enough to support large glass panels but light enough to operate smoothly.
The engineering behind this strength-to-weight ratio is pretty cool too.
Aluminium door frames often have internal chambers that add structural integrity without adding much weight.
It’s like how a hollow tube can be stronger than a solid rod in some situations—smart design makes all the difference.
Enhanced Energy Efficiency
Now, you might be thinking, “Wait, isn’t metal a conductor? Wouldn’t aluminium doors leak heat?” That’s how the old ones worked, but modern aluminium doors are totally different.
Today’s aluminium doors use what’s called “thermal break technology.”
This is basically a barrier inside the frame that stops heat or cold from transferring from outside to inside.
It’s like putting a piece of rubber between two metal parts so the temperature can’t travel across.
Quality aluminium doors also come with double or even triple glazing options.
These multiple panes of glass with gas (usually argon) trapped between them act as amazing insulators.
They keep your cool air in during summer and your warm air in during winter.
The tight seals around aluminium doors also prevent drafts.
Since aluminium doesn’t expand and contract much with temperature changes, the weatherstripping stays snug year-round.
All this adds up to lower energy bills and more comfortable living spaces.
You won’t feel that cold draft when you walk by your doors in winter, and your AC won’t have to work overtime in summer.
Excellent Sound Insulation
Living on a busy street? Near an airport? Have noisy neighbors? Aluminium doors can help create a quieter home environment.
The same features that make these doors energy-efficient also make them great sound barriers.
Those thermal breaks I mentioned earlier? They also break sound waves. And double or triple glazing doesn’t just stop temperature transfer—it stops noise too.
The solid construction and tight seals of aluminium doors prevent sound leaks that are common with warped wood doors or poorly fitted options.
For home offices, bedrooms, or media rooms, this sound insulation can be a game-changer.
You can enjoy movie night without street noise interrupting the best scenes, or take Zoom calls without your colleagues hearing every passing car.
Some manufacturers even offer special acoustic glass options for aluminium doors that provide extra sound dampening for homes in extra-noisy locations.
Eco-Friendly and Sustainable Choice
If you care about your environmental footprint, aluminium doors deserve a serious look.
First off, aluminium is 100% recyclable.
That means when (many, many years from now) you finally replace your doors, they won’t end up in a landfill. They can be completely recycled to make new products.
Even better, recycling aluminium uses just 5% of the energy needed to produce new aluminium.
And about 75% of all aluminium ever produced is still in use today because it gets recycled over and over.
The longevity of aluminium doors also means fewer replacements over time, which reduces manufacturing and transportation impacts.
And their energy efficiency helps reduce your home’s overall energy consumption.
Many aluminium door manufacturers now use recycled content in their products too, further reducing the environmental impact. Some even run their facilities on renewable energy.
For green building projects or homeowners looking to make eco-friendly choices, aluminium doors check a lot of boxes.
Improved Security Features
Your home’s security starts at its entry points, and aluminium doors offer some serious peace of mind.
The inherent strength of aluminium means these doors can stand up to force.
They won’t crack, split, or break like some other materials might when someone tries to kick them in.
Modern aluminium doors come with multi-point locking systems that secure the door in several places along the frame, not just at the handle.
This makes them extremely difficult to force open.
The frames can also accommodate advanced security glass that’s laminated or tempered to resist breaking.
Even if someone manages to break the glass, they’d still have to get through multiple layers that stay intact and in the frame.
For sliding doors, look for models with anti-lift mechanisms that prevent burglars from simply lifting doors off their tracks (a common vulnerability with older sliding doors).
Many aluminium door systems can also integrate with smart home security, allowing for keyless entry, remote locking, and security monitoring.
Versatility in Design and Application
Maybe the best thing about aluminium doors is how versatile they are.
They work in practically any setting or style of home.
Need french doors for your bedroom balcony? Aluminium works great.
Want sliding doors for your pool area? Perfect. Looking for a grand entrance with sidelights? Aluminium can do that too.
They come in configurations to fit any opening: hinged, sliding, folding, pivot, stacking—you name it. And because aluminium can be extruded into virtually any shape, manufacturers can create custom designs to fit unique spaces.
The finishes available are just as diverse as the configurations.
Beyond standard colors, you can get textured finishes that mimic wood grain (without the maintenance headaches of real wood), metallic finishes for an ultra-modern look, or even dual finishes with different colors inside and out.
This versatility extends to glass options too. Clear, frosted, tinted, decorative, energy-efficient, sound-reducing—there’s a glass option for every need and preference.
